https://bugs.kde.org/show_bug.cgi?id=433715
Bug ID: 433715 Summary: krunner crashes when input contains a quote Product: krunner Version: 5.21.1 Platform: Other OS: Linux Status: REPORTED Severity: normal Priority: NOR Component: general Assignee: alexander.loh...@gmx.de Reporter: mat.muel...@mailbox.org CC: plasma-b...@kde.org Target Milestone: --- SUMMARY krunner crashes when you type a quotation mark into it. Was observed by me and another manjaro-user in an update-thread. STEPS TO REPRODUCE 1. type a single ( ' ) or double quote ( " ) in krunner 2. observe crash ;) SOFTWARE/OS VERSIONS KDE Plasma Version: 5.21.1 KDE Frameworks Version: 5.79.0 Qt Version: 5.15.2 ADDITIONAL INFORMATION here are three core dumps from said other user: Stack trace of thread 22637: #0 0x00007f465480bc92 _ZN6KShell11tildeExpandERK7QString (libKF5CoreAddons.so.5 + 0x62c92) #1 0x00007f463808a74b n/a (krunner_locations.so + 0x374b) #2 0x00007f464c136ca8 _ZN6Plasma14AbstractRunner12performMatchERNS_13RunnerContextE (libKF5Runner.so.5 + 0xfca8) #3 0x00007f464c141095 n/a (libKF5Runner.so.5 + 0x1a095) #4 0x00007f464c114709 _ZN12ThreadWeaver8Executor3runERK14QSharedPointerINS_12JobInterfaceEEPNS_6ThreadE (libKF5ThreadWeaver.so.5 + 0x1a709) #5 0x00007f464c113722 _ZN12ThreadWeaver3Job7executeERK14QSharedPointerINS_12JobInterfaceEEPNS_6ThreadE (libKF5ThreadWeaver.so.5 + 0x19722) #6 0x00007f464c112fb1 _ZN12ThreadWeaver6Thread3runEv (libKF5ThreadWeaver.so.5 + 0x18fb1) #7 0x00007f4653c51eff n/a (libQt5Core.so.5 + 0xcdeff) #8 0x00007f46531e4299 start_thread (libpthread.so.0 + 0x9299) #9 0x00007f46538d9053 __clone (libc.so.6 + 0xff053) Stack trace of thread 22640: #0 0x00007f46531f09ba __futex_abstimed_wait_common64 (libpthread.so.0 + 0x159ba) #1 0x00007f46531ea260 pthread_cond_wait@@GLIBC_2.3.2 (libpthread.so.0 + 0xf260) #2 0x00007f4653c580c4 _ZN14QWaitCondition4waitEP6QMutex14QDeadlineTimer (libQt5Core.so.5 + 0xd40c4) #3 0x00007f46548a8095 n/a (libQt5DBus.so.5 + 0x65095) #4 0x00007f46548a8762 _ZN23QDBusPendingCallWatcher15waitForFinishedEv (libQt5DBus.so.5 + 0x65762) #5 0x00007f464c13c40d n/a (libKF5Runner.so.5 + 0x1540d) #6 0x00007f464c136ca8 _ZN6Plasma14AbstractRunner12performMatchERNS_13RunnerContextE (libKF5Runner.so.5 + 0xfca8) #7 0x00007f464c141095 n/a (libKF5Runner.so.5 + 0x1a095) #8 0x00007f464c114709 _ZN12ThreadWeaver8Executor3runERK14QSharedPointerINS_12JobInterfaceEEPNS_6ThreadE (libKF5ThreadWeaver.so.5 + 0x1a709) #9 0x00007f464c113722 _ZN12ThreadWeaver3Job7executeERK14QSharedPointerINS_12JobInterfaceEEPNS_6ThreadE (libKF5ThreadWeaver.so.5 + 0x19722) #10 0x00007f464c112fb1 _ZN12ThreadWeaver6Thread3runEv (libKF5ThreadWeaver.so.5 + 0x18fb1) #11 0x00007f4653c51eff n/a (libQt5Core.so.5 + 0xcdeff) #12 0x00007f46531e4299 start_thread (libpthread.so.0 + 0x9299) #13 0x00007f46538d9053 __clone (libc.so.6 + 0xff053) Stack trace of thread 22636: #0 0x00007f46538d3a9d syscall (libc.so.6 + 0xf9a9d) #1 0x00007f4653c52256 _ZN11QBasicMutex12lockInternalEv (libQt5Core.so.5 + 0xce256) #2 0x00007f4653c5808f _ZN14QWaitCondition4waitEP6QMutex14QDeadlineTimer (libQt5Core.so.5 + 0xd408f) #3 0x00007f464c1117c1 _ZN12ThreadWeaver6Weaver36takeFirstAvailableJobOrSuspendOrWaitEPNS_6ThreadEbbb (libKF5ThreadWeaver.so.5 + 0x177c1) #4 0x00007f464c115439 n/a (libKF5ThreadWeaver.so.5 + 0x1b439) #5 0x00007f464c1108a3 _ZN12ThreadWeaver6Weaver12applyForWorkEPNS_6ThreadEb (libKF5ThreadWeaver.so.5 + 0x168a3) #6 0x00007f464c115491 n/a (libKF5ThreadWeaver.so.5 + 0x1b491) #7 0x00007f464c1108a3 _ZN12ThreadWeaver6Weaver12applyForWorkEPNS_6ThreadEb (libKF5ThreadWeaver.so.5 + 0x168a3) #8 0x00007f464c115491 n/a (libKF5ThreadWeaver.so.5 + 0x1b491) #9 0x00007f464c1108a3 _ZN12ThreadWeaver6Weaver12applyForWorkEPNS_6ThreadEb (libKF5ThreadWeaver.so.5 + 0x168a3) #10 0x00007f464c115491 n/a (libKF5ThreadWeaver.so.5 + 0x1b491) -- You are receiving this mail because: You are watching all bug changes.